Key Highlights

  • Graphic Novel Feature: Bruce Dickinson, vocalist of Iron Maiden, announces the release of "The Mandrake Project: Year One," a 184-page graphic novel collecting the first four issues of his comic series.
  • Innovative Collaboration: The graphic novel includes contributions from notable artists such as Tony Lee, Staz Johnson, and Bill Sienkiewicz, along with an introduction by Kurt Sutter.
  • Tour Announcement: Dickinson will embark on a North American tour in August 2025, coinciding with the graphic novel’s release.

The Genesis of The Mandrake Project

The Mandrake Project stems from Dickinson's most recent solo album, released after a nearly two-decade hiatus, titled "The Mandrake Project." The album, characterized by its dark themes and evocative lyrics, explores concepts of transformation, identity, and the subconscious. Through a collaborative effort with writer Tony Lee, artist Staz Johnson, and colorist Piotr Kowalski, the album's themes were adapted into a comic series, published across four issues.

What to Expect from the Graphic Novel

Scheduled for an August 2025 release, "The Mandrake Project: Year One" promises a lavish presentation, crafted to captivate readers both visually and thematically. The hardcover edition, featuring a limited-edition cover illustrated by acclaimed artist Bill Sienkiewicz, invites collectors and fans alike to engage with the narrative on multiple levels.

Exclusive Content

Among its features, the graphic novel includes:

  • A Prologue: Previously exclusive to the vinyl release of the single “The Afterglow of Ragnarok,” this introductory piece sets the tone for an immersive experience.
  • An Insightful Introduction: Authored by Kurt Sutter, creator of "Sons of Anarchy," this introduction adds depth to understanding Dickinson’s creative journey.
  • Visual Aids: An essay, photos, and artwork collectively cover what can be described as a “Year in the Life” of The Mandrake Project—documenting not just the comic series but the music and touring experience that shadow it.

Contributions and Collaborations

Z2 Comics, the publisher behind this graphic novel, has emphasized the collaborative spirit that Dickinson inspired. Rantz Hoseley, Z2's Editor-in-Chief, expressed the challenges and triumphs of bringing such a complex project to fruition, stating, “You pray for collaborators like Bruce Dickinson.”

Touring in Conjunction with Release

To complement the graphic novel, Dickinson is set to embark on a North American tour starting in August 2025. This tour will include a key show at Brooklyn Paramount on September 10. The dates are not merely promotional but provide fans an opportunity to engage with The Mandrake Project in a live setting, highlighting the interwoven relationship between music and the visual arts:

  • August 22 - House of Blues, Anaheim, CA
  • August 23 - House of Blues, Las Vegas, NV
  • August 25 - Marquee Theatre, Phoenix, AZ
  • September 10 - Brooklyn Paramount, Brooklyn, NY
  • And more across North America.
